The Park City Community Foundation announced on September 9, 2026, that it delivered $11.8 million in community impact to Park City and Summit County during its 2026 fiscal year. This figure brings the organization's cumulative community impact since 2007 to $96.3 million.
During the 2026 fiscal year, which ran from July 2025 through June 2026, the foundation distributed $4.7 million through 794 grants to local nonprofits. These grants originated from various sources, including the foundation's own initiatives, funds, and Donor Advised Funds.
The foundation also facilitated $5.5 million in donations via the annual Live PC Give PC giving day. Additionally, $1.6 million was invested into program delivery through the Women’s Giving Fund, Zero Food Waste, Early Childhood Alliance, and Youth United programs.
The foundation's latest round of Community Fund grants totaled $475,000 and was distributed to 55 local nonprofits. Deer Valley Resort contributed $100,000 toward these funds. The Community Fund is intended to provide unrestricted dollars to organizations that provide essential services across the county.
CEO Joel Zarrow stated that local nonprofits serve as the lifeblood of the community and noted that the foundation's support of the nonprofit sector through grants and wide-ranging assistance makes healthcare, arts and culture, education, sports and recreation, and belonging possible through collective giving.
